What is Multilingual SEO in the AI Era?

Multilingual SEO is the technical and semantic practice of optimizing a website so that traditional search engines and AI language models can accurately crawl, index, retrieve, and serve the correct language or regional version of a page for a specific user.

In the reasoning economy, multilingual SEO extends into Generative Engine Optimization (GEO). The goal is not just to rank in a local SERP. The goal is to become the trusted source that AI systems cite when answering localized questions.

1. Implement Dedicated URL Structures

To maintain a clean global hierarchy, separate language versions into distinct, crawlable URL pathways. Avoid dynamic URL parameters such as ?lang=es and avoid browser-only translation widgets, because crawlers often cannot treat them as independent localized pages.

URL Architecture Example Format Technical SEO Impact
Subdirectories example.com/fr/ Highly recommended. Consolidates domain authority, centralizes link equity, and is easiest to maintain at scale.
Subdomains de.example.com Moderate. Useful for decentralized international teams, but may fragment authority across properties.
ccTLDs example.co.uk High cost / high trust. Strong local relevance, but every market needs separate SEO authority building.

⚠️ Technical Warning

Never use IP-based automatic redirects to force crawlers into one language folder. Googlebot and many AI crawlers may access sites from US-based locations. If you force-redirect them, they may never discover your international pages.

✅ Critical Localization Step

Translate your URL slugs. An English slug on a German site, such as /de/pricing, creates cognitive friction. A localized slug such as /de/preise better matches regional search intent.

2. Deploy Flawless Hreflang Tags

Hreflang tags are the technical backbone of global search. They act as a relational map, telling search engines which language and regional version of a page to serve to each user. Without a correct hreflang cluster, translated pages can look like duplicates and compete against each other.

Hreflang Cluster Rules

01

Bidirectional confirmation: every language page must point back to every other language page in the cluster.

02

x-default fallback: specify the default page for users whose language does not match a localized version.

03

<link rel="alternate" hreflang="en" href="https://example.com/" />
<link rel="alternate" hreflang="fr" href="https://example.com/fr/" />
<link rel="alternate" hreflang="de" href="https://example.com/de/" />
<link rel="alternate" hreflang="x-default" href="https://example.com/" />

Pro Tip: For large websites with 10+ languages, hreflang in XML sitemaps can be cleaner than placing every alternate tag inside every HTML page. It reduces page-head complexity and can simplify monitoring with a sitemap validation workflow.

3. Prioritize Deep Localization Over Literal Translation

Literal word-swapping is a liability. When an English industry idiom is directly translated into French, Spanish, Hindi, or Japanese, it may become technically readable but locally irrelevant. This is semantic drift: the page is translated, but it no longer matches how people search or how AI engines classify intent.

🗣️

The Localization Quality Layer

Native Intent Mapping

Adapt messaging to local search terms, buyer vocabulary, legal norms, and cultural expectations.

Factual Density

Add localized proof, examples, FAQs, pricing context, and native expert terminology.

AI Extractability

Use concise sections, clean headings, and atomic paragraphs so models can retrieve facts confidently.

4. Use Entity Disambiguation with Multilingual Schema

Modern search has moved from strings to entities. Schema markup, especially JSON-LD, translates your human-readable page into structured information that machines can understand quickly. For global websites, schema prevents algorithms from treating each language version as a disconnected brand.

🆔

Consistent @id

Use the same organization identifier across all language versions to unify your brand entity.

🌐

Translate values, not code

Localize names, descriptions, offers, job titles, reviews, and product details.

Frequently Asked Questions

Does translating my website automatically improve SEO?

No. Simple translation creates readable content for humans, but it does not provide the backend infrastructure search engines need. You still need hreflang tags, localized URL slugs, translated metadata, schema markup, clean canonical signals, and indexable page structures.

Can I use AI tools like ChatGPT for website translation?

AI translation is fast, but generic output often misses local search intent, cultural nuance, glossary consistency, and technical SEO setup. A specialized website translation workflow combines AI speed with SEO, glossary, URL, schema, and hreflang automation.

What is the difference between multilingual SEO and multilingual GEO?

Multilingual SEO focuses on ranking translated pages in traditional search results. Multilingual GEO focuses on structuring localized content so AI answer engines can retrieve, synthesize, and cite your brand as the source of truth. Explore the full distinction in the Multilingual GEO Guide.

Do I need a different domain for every country?

Not necessarily. ccTLDs can create strong local trust, but they are expensive to manage and require separate authority building. For most SaaS, ecommerce, and B2B brands, localized subdirectories such as /fr/ or /de/ are easier to scale.

How do I prevent AI engines from mixing up regional data?

Use flawless bidirectional hreflang tags, consistent canonical logic, localized schema values, and unique regional details. This prevents AI systems from showing UK pricing to a US buyer or merging separate language pages into a single ambiguous source.
